Weather in March

The first month of the autumn, March, is also a moderately hot month in Ngampilan, Indonesia, with temperature in the range of an average low of 23°C (73.4°F) and an average high of 28.9°C (84°F).

Temperature

As Ngampilan steps into March, the average high-temperature is measured at a still warm 28.9°C (84°F), displaying minor differences from February's 28.7°C (83.7°F). Throughout March, Ngampilan registers a consistent average low-temperature of 23°C (73.4°F).

Heat index

The heat index value during March is computed to be a sweltering 35°C (95°F). Exercise heightened safety, heat cramps and heat exhaustion are probable. Persistent activity may provoke heatstroke.
For clarity, heat index numbers account for light winds and areas under shade. Direct sunlight exposure may result in a rise of the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'apparent temperature', is the result of factoring in humidity to the air temperature, indicating perceived warmth. An individual's perception of weather can be affected by a variety of elements including metabolic differences, being pregnant, and their level of physical exertion. Direct sunlight can potentially raise the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ees, so it's crucial to consider. Heat index values are extremely vital to babies and toddlers. Juveniles are regularly less conscious of the need to recuperate and rehydrate. Thirst is a tardy symptom of dehydration - hydration, especially during lengthy physical activities, should be maintained.
To offset high temperatures, the human body releases sweat which, upon evaporation, cools it down. With a lot of moisture in the air, the evaporation process is not as effective, and the body does not cool down as efficiently, creating a perception of overheating. Heat disorders may be on the horizon when body temperatures rise from inadequate heat management.

Humidity

The average relative humidity in March is 83%.

Rainfall

March is the month with the most rainfall. Rain falls for 29.8 days and accumulates 236mm (9.29") of precipitation.

Daylight

The average length of the day in March is 12h and 9min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 05:43 and sunset at 17:58. On the last day of March, sunrise is at 05:41 and sunset at 17:43 WIB.

Sunshine

In Ngampilan, the average sunshine in March is 8.1h.

UV index

The months with the highest UV index are February, March and October, with an average maximum UV index of 7.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health hazard from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for the average person.
Note: An average maximum UV index of 7 in March leads to these recommendations:
Take precautions against overexposure. Fair-skinned people may get burned in less than 20 minutes. Be aware that the sun's UV radiation is strongest between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m. and try to reduce direct sun exposure during this period as much as possible. Sunglasses that guard against UVA and UVB rays are pivotal in minimizing sun-induced ocular damage.
